20090006169 | IDENTIFICATION, CATEGORIZATION, AND INTEGRATION OF UNPLANNED MAINTENANCE, REPAIR AND OVERHAUL WORK ON MECHANICAL EQUIPMENT - An automated interactive method dynamically identifies an unplanned maintenance task during execution of a planned maintenance task on equipment. A user device displays a maintenance menu system for data entry and access and provides an input relating to unplanned maintenance task discovered on the equipment. The unplanned maintenance task is associated with the planned maintenance task at least with respect to a location. The automated interactive method sequentially processes unplanned maintenance task information based on the input from the user device. The automated interactive method establishes and stores an unplanned maintenance task data record including a selected geographical location, a selected item, a selected work category, a selected task type, a selected task description, and selected component data of the unplanned maintenance task. | 01-01-2009 |
20090125277 | COMPUTERIZED PREDICTIVE MAINTENANCE SYSTEM AND METHOD - A computerized system for performing predictive maintenance on an item of equipment includes a desired configuration database, an actual configuration database and a data processor. The data processor determines if an actual configuration complies with a desired configuration. The data processor determines an upgrade requirement for upgrading the actual configuration to the desired configuration if the actual configuration is noncompliant. The data processor further defines an interim solution that eliminates delay in the execution of the upgrade requirement on the item of equipment. | 05-14-2009 |

20110252132 | METHODS, APPARATUS AND SYSTEMS FOR PROVIDING AND MONITORING SECURE INFORMATION VIA MULTIPLE AUTHORIZED CHANNELS AND GENERATING ALERTS RELATING TO SAME - Display of and access to secure user-centric information via the construct of a channel grid framework serving as a desktop on a user device. Multiple authorized channels through which the user receives and/or interacts with respective portions of the secure user-centric information are implemented based on information access rights and/or security protocols respectively associated with the channels. Channel information is monitored to determine one or more events, conditions, logical workflows, discrete information values or signal data, based on one or more threshold conditions or parameters relating to the channel information. Actionable and/or non-actionable alerts may be generated on one or more authenticated user devices and/or other devices. Information relating to determination of one or more events, conditions, logical workflows, discrete information values or signal data may be transmitted to various devices and/or stored for archival purposes. | 10-13-2011 |
20110252460 | METHODS, APPARATUS AND SYSTEMS FOR AUTHENTICATING USERS AND USER DEVICES TO RECEIVE SECURE INFORMATION VIA MULTIPLE AUTHORIZED CHANNELS - Facilitating display of, and interaction with, secure user-centric information via a user platform operated by a user. A user identity is transmitted to an external computing device hosting an identity management server to authenticate the user. After authenticating, a desktop channel grid framework is displayed on the user platform. The channel grid framework includes multiple channels having respective contents represented as multiple user-selectable items, through which respective portions of the secure user-centric information are presented. At least some of the secure user-centric information in at least one channel is based on the user identity, and in displaying the at least one channel as a selectable item, the at least one channel is authenticated by the identity management server. In one example, the user platform also is authenticated, and multiple user-selectable items included in the channel grid framework is based on information access rights and/or security protocols respectively associated with the corresponding plurality of authorized channels, the user, and the user platform. | 10-13-2011 |
